The Sea-Dog 4208711 Hi-Amp Surface Mount Resettable Circuit Breaker (30 amps, 48 volts) is a single-pole, thermal-type overcurrent protection device with a visible tripped condition indicator. Designed for surface mounting, it’s built for marine environments where splash exposure is a concern, including engine compartment and bilge area applications.
Key Features
- Single pole thermal type resettable circuit breaker with visible indication of tripped condition
- 30 amp rating for overcurrent protection on appropriately sized branch circuits
- Surface mount design—no mounting panel required
- Water resistant/sealed construction intended for engine compartment and bilge area applications
- Stainless steel studs and washers with thermoset plastic body
- CE certified
- Interrupt level of 3000 amperes

Parts Desk Insights
Best Use Case: Use this resettable breaker when you want branch-circuit overcurrent protection at 30A on a 48V system, with a surface-mounted option and a clear visual cue when a fault trips the breaker.
Common Issues: If nuisance trips occur, confirm the load is within the breaker’s intended rating and review wiring for short circuits or excessive current draw. Also double-check the mounting/spacing against the A–E dimensions during installation to ensure proper seating and secure contact at the stainless studs and washers.
